How to Make Emerald in Infinite Craft

The main component for making Green in Infinite Craft is making an Emerald. Emerald requires several steps to create, but thankfully it's a fairly simple process.

First, combine Earth and Water to make Plant.

Second, combine Earth and Fire to make Lava, then combine Lava and Water to create Stone.

Now, mix your Stone with Lava to make Obsidian, then combine Obsidian and Earth to create Diamond.

Finally, combine Diamond and Plant to make Emerald.

Making Green in Infinite Craft

Combining the Emerald and Fire you created will give you the desired Green - but why?

Emerald is, famously, a rich green gemstone. Some might say that the very essence of Emeralds is the color green. Adding Fire to this brilliant green stone should distill it down to its very essence, the color Green, in the AI’s eyes anyway (I don’t think Infinite Craft’s AI has eyes, but you know what I mean).
